Area, Ethnic, and Cultural Studies Teachers, Postsecondary H-1B salary at THE UNIVERSITY OF TENNESSEE: $67,490 average ($48,480-$86,500 range).
THE UNIVERSITY OF TENNESSEE has sponsored 2 H-1B petitions for Area, Ethnic, and Cultural Studies Teachers, Postsecondary roles, with salaries ranging from $48k to $87k. The average offered salary of $67k is 33% above the prevailing wage for this occupation. Most positions are located in Tennessee (100%). The certification rate is 100%. 100% of these filings are for new employment.
